Welcome to FareForge, our rules engine for shipping fees. Quick orientation before you start reviewing PRs: rules live in `rules/` as YAML, get compiled into a decision tree at deploy, and are evaluated per-cart in under 5ms. Most review comments boil down to two things — rule precedence (lower number wins, yes it's backwards, we know) and currency rounding. To run the evaluator locally against the staging tariff service, you'll need to authenticate. Staging accepts the internal key shown below.

app token of yajeg-kawef = kto11_7En3XSX8xQw

Management Meeting Minutes — Harwick Lease

Attendees: operations, finance, regional leads. Apologies: T. Moresby.

Finance reported the Harwick depot landlord has agreed in principle to a five-year renewal at a 6% reduction, conditional on us taking the adjacent unit. Operations confirmed the extra space suits planned fulfilment volumes. Branch managers should hold off on any relocation chatter with staff until terms are signed. Action: finance to circulate draft heads of terms. The underlying expansion context is recorded below.

confidential, kagup-bafog: Fraaxax Group is in early talks to buy Soroxox Group for about $343.8 million. The Olidor launch date is June 14, and nothing goes to the press before then. Legal wants the Aldmirek Logistics term sheet signed before July 23.

Handover for the Ledgerbarn archive tables. Since March we partition order history by calendar month; new partitions are created three days ahead by the maintenance job, and partitions older than 18 months are detached, not dropped. If support sees "partition not found" errors near month boundaries, the creation job likely failed — rerun it before escalating. Queries missing a date filter will scan everything and time out. The partitioning job runs with the configuration values below.

config for kafof-bawef:
holath:
  log_level: debug
  metrics_host: metrics.holath.qorvelsys.internal
  pin: 2191
  pool_size: 32